Understanding the Basics: Key Statistical Categories
Before diving into specific sports, it’s vital to grasp the fundamental statistical categories that underpin any successful betting strategy. These categories provide the building blocks for your analysis.
Team Statistics
Team statistics offer a comprehensive view of a team’s performance. Focus on these key areas:
- Goals/Points Scored: This is a fundamental metric. Analyze the average goals/points scored per game, both at home and away. Look for trends – is the team consistently high-scoring, or do they struggle to find the net?
- Goals/Points Conceded: Equally important is the number of goals/points a team allows. A strong defense is crucial. Compare their goals conceded to those of their opponents.
- Possession: In sports like football (soccer), possession can indicate control of the game. However, it’s not always a direct indicator of success. Analyze how a team utilizes its possession – are they creating scoring opportunities?
- Shots on Target/Attempts: This shows a team’s offensive efficiency. A team that consistently gets shots on target is more likely to score.
- Corners/Free Kicks: These can indicate attacking potential and opportunities for set-piece goals.
Player Statistics
Individual player performance significantly impacts team results. Consider these player-specific stats:
- Goals/Assists (Football): Key indicators of a player’s offensive contribution.
- Goals/Points (Other Sports): Similar to football, these are crucial metrics for assessing a player’s scoring ability in other sports like basketball or ice hockey.
- Minutes Played: A player’s playing time can indicate their importance to the team and their physical condition.
- Form: Recent performance is critical. Look at a player’s stats over the last few games to identify trends – are they in good form, or are they struggling?
- Injuries and Suspensions: Always check for player injuries or suspensions, as these can significantly impact a team’s performance.
Applying Statistics to Specific Sports
The specific statistics you analyze will vary depending on the sport. Here’s a look at some popular sports in Norway:
Football (Soccer)
Football is a statistics-rich sport. In addition to the general team and player stats, consider:
- Head-to-Head Records: Analyze the historical results between the two teams.
- Home/Away Form: Teams often perform differently at home versus away.
- Expected Goals (xG): This advanced metric measures the quality of scoring chances, providing a more nuanced understanding of a team’s offensive performance.
- Yellow/Red Cards: Discipline can significantly impact a game’s outcome.
Ice Hockey
Ice hockey is another sport heavily influenced by statistics. Key stats include:
- Shots on Goal: A high number of shots often correlates with scoring opportunities.
- Power Play Percentage: How effective is a team on the power play?
- Penalty Kill Percentage: How well does a team defend against power plays?
- Save Percentage (Goaltenders): A goalie’s performance is crucial.
Handball
Handball, a popular sport in Norway, demands analysis of these statistics:
- Goals Scored/Conceded: Focus on the scoring ability and defensive strength of the teams.
- Shooting Percentage: This indicates the efficiency of the offensive plays.
- Turnovers: Minimizing turnovers is crucial for maintaining possession.
- Goalkeeper Saves: Goalkeeper performance is a key factor.
Advanced Statistical Analysis: Taking it to the Next Level
Once you’re comfortable with the basics, consider these advanced techniques:
Regression Analysis
This statistical method can identify relationships between different variables. For example, you might analyze how a team’s possession percentage correlates with its scoring rate.
Using Data Visualization Tools
Tools like graphs and charts can help you visualize data and identify trends more easily. This can be especially helpful when comparing multiple teams or players.
